The Espace 1606 is a space dedicated to the history of Fribourg, with a 3D representation of the city of Fribourg according to the Martini map dating from 1606.
The 52 m2 model faithfully reproduces the architecture and topography of the city of Fribourg in the 17th century. Every detail has been meticulously worked out. Gothic houses, towers, gardens and ramparts are depicted to allow visitors to immerse themselves in the Fribourg of the past time. Beyond its didactic role, L'Espace 1606 is the result of a long term work to highlight the indisputable historical and socio-cultural heritage of Fribourg's still visible in the magnificent Old Town of Fribourg. The work, built by unemployed people from Fribourg, was developed thanks to the efforts of the Werkhof-Frima association.
A short history:
The Werkhof was built in 1555 by the weaving family Weber family and first served as a weaving mill, later the Werkhof was used for various activities over decades. It was destroyed by the fire and renovated in 2018 to house an exhibition space, a multi-purpose hall, an after-school reception area and the Espace 1606.
